Ex-HealthSouth CEO Repays Nearly $48 Million (January 6, 2006)

January 6, 2006

As a result of a law suit, former HealthSouth Corp. CEO Richard Scrushy has been ordered to repay $48 million in bonuses.  The bonuses were received from 1997 to 2002 for his role in the company’s achievements which were fabricated and never actually achieved.  The suit was brought as a derivative suit, and the money recovered will be returned to the company.
